Storyline

<p>Anand, an professional recently moves to from with his pregnant wife Binu Thrivikraman. During a routine police check in their neighbourhood, Anand learns that his wife’s name is being included in the “KAAPA” (Kerala Anti-Social Activities Prevention Act) list, a list that includes the names of all the local gangsters. Anand decides to clear Binu’s name and sends her to his hometown to have a safe pregnancy. Later, Anand meets Arumanayagam, a police constable to seek his help for removing Binu’s name, and soon learns about her involvement in leading a gang and her rivalry with the city’s leading gangster and upcoming politician Kotta Madhu, as Madhu was responsible for Binu’s brother’s death. Anand meets Kotta Madhu and manages to earn his trust in order to help Binu. Later, Anand learns that a reporter named Latheef has hired goons to finish Madhu and informs Prameela, who later informs Madhu. Madhu thrashes them and Latheef gets scared of getting caught by Madhu. Anand travels to Binu’s hometown and arranges their baby’s naming ceremony. Latheef meets Anand and reveals about his rivalry with Madhu resulted in his cousin Nazeer getting exiled to , where he tells Anand to form a truce between him and Madhu in order to live a peaceful life. Though relucant, Madhu agrees and arrives at the spot where the truce is held, but Madhu is killed in a bomb blast by a boy, whose life was severely damaged by Madhu as he bombed an assassin due to his orders and was sent to . Anand pays his last respect to Madhu and leaves the premises, where he feels guilty about being used by Latheef. After Madhu’s report, Prameela learns that Binu is wearing Madhu’s ring; thus revealing that she was the mastermind behind Madhu’s death and Latheef was her family-friend. Binu was also the faceless leader leading a gang and attempted to kill Madhu while Anand was busy to prove her innocence. Prameela calls Binu and swears that she will avenge Madhu’s death, while Binu also promises to protect her family without Anand’s knowledge. On 17 August 2021, announced that and would be launching a project on 18 August, the next day. That day, 18 August, the motion poster was shared by them and the title was revealed to be . The film was initiated by Fefka Writers Union. The title is the short form of an act called . was the director. But in May 2022, Venu opted out of the film as director due to creative differences between him and Fefka Writers Union. He was then replaced by . Cinematographer , editor and musician were the initial technical crew of the film. They were later replaced by , and musicians and respectively. The film was scripted by based on his novel . The film was initially announced with the cast of Prithviraj Sukumaran, , and . However, Manju Warrier left the film as she was busy with her schedules on shooting for ‘s (2023). came as the replacement. Actors , and were later revealed to be part of the cast. Filming was to begin on 20 May 2022 but was postponed due to Venu opting out of the film. began on 15 July 2022 in VJT Hall, . On 16 July, director Shaji Kailas sought permission from Chief Minister for a day’s shooting in the area around the as the had enforced a ban there for shooting. Sukumaran gave a 60 days date for the filming of . An action scene with Sukumaran was shot on 26 July. Filming came to a conclusion on 16 September 2022. and composed the film’s music. All recordings were done at . The first single titled “Yamam Veendum Vinnile” was released on 16 December 2022 while the second single, “Thiru Thiru Thiruvananthapurathu”, was released on 19 December 2022. was released theatrically on 22 December 2022 during . had its post-theatrical streaming on starting from 19 January 2023.
